2007 not saving changes?!

Q

QB

At first I thought maybe it was my imagination, but now I am able to
replicate this fault a multitude of times.

I can work on a form, change a cbo's RowSource (SQL) and say yes to save
change when closing the QBE. Close the form (which doesn't propmt to save
changes?) and when I reopen the form my changes are gone!?

I work in the VBE modifying a function I am working on, force the save (icon
or file->save) close the form and reopen and my changes are gone?!

What is going on? This NEVER happened in 2003!

I love working with Access, but doing the work once is more than enough for
me. Is this a known issue? Is there a fix?

I already did a compact and repair, no change in behavior.

Suggestions:

1. Make sure you have applied Service Pack 2 for Office 2007. There was a
bug like this that was fixed in SP1 or SP2. You can download SP2 from:
http://www.microsoft.com/downloads/...18-79ea-46c6-8a81-9db49b4ab6e5&displaylang=en

2. After you change the RowSource property, do both of these:
a) Move to a different property in the Properties box, and
b) Explicitly save changes before closing the form.

3. If you are still stuck at this point, follow the steps in this recovery
sequence in order:
http://allenbrowne.com/recover.html
